ST. HENRY - The village will soon have a new leader after council members at Monday night's meeting accepted mayor Jeff Mescher's resignation, effective Jan. 1.
"I have accepted a new position that requires my relocation outside of Ohio," Mescher said. "I will truly miss St. Henry, and I wish you all the best."
Council members expressed sadness at Mescher's announcement and wished him luck. [More]
Flights permitted only for small devices
By William Kincaid
CELINA - The flight of unmanned aerial vehicles or drones will be largely banned in the city limits once legislation approved by city council members on Monday night goes into effect in 30 days.
The ordinance initially banned drones over city-owned property but on its final reading, councilman Jeff Larmore made a motion to amend the legislation to prohibit drone use anywhere in the city limits. [More]

Village to advertise acreage for sale or lease it purchased in 2014
COLDWATER - Plans have changed for two properties over which village officials have control.
Council members at Monday's meeting voted unanimously after a 20-minute executive session to advertise for sale or lease 34.821 acres the village owns in Butler Township.
CELINA - Celina Postmaster Paul Joseph will be the guest speaker at the Veterans Day services Wednesday at Lake Shore Park.
Tom Risch, Mercer County Veterans Service officer, said the annual event will begin at 10:45 a.m. at the veterans monument. Risch will serve as master of ceremonies.

Razz-Eye View
Another season, another blistering start to the football playoffs for the MAC teams.
Since the expansion to eight teams per region, the MAC is a combined 64-6 in opening round games. Take away intra-conference matchups and the record is an unbelievable 60-2.
